Summary

I rencently got my MS Degree (Computer Science) from University of Southern California(USC). I am currently looking for a Full-Time Software Engineer position beginning in Fall 2016.

I am dedicated to developing human-friendly applications. My interests include Human-computer interaction, Data Visualization, Game Development, and some aspect of Machine Learning. I worked as an full-stack engineer in Yahoo Taiwan, mainly focusing on creative advertising presentation.

My technical expertise includes cross-platform proficiency (Window and Linux); different programming languages including Python, Java, Javascript, Web; and advanced knowledge of Algorithm, Data Structure and OOP.

Resume

Education

Master's degree, Computer Science, GPA 3.92/4
2014 – 2016

Bachelor's, Computer Science, GPA 3.6/4
2007 – 2011

Technical Skills

Programming Experience: Python, Java, Javascript, C++, C
Web Experience: LAMP, NodeJS, ExpressJs, React, JQuery, Bootstrap, Semantic-UI
iOS Experience: Swift, SpriteKit
Database Experience: MySQL, MongoDB, Firebase, SQLite, Spatial SQL
Others: Linux, Vim

Programming

Web

iOS

Database

Work Experience

Developed a suite of products for advertising solutions with web tech (javascript and iframe), mainly focused on Keyword Ads.
Developed an advertising platform SOEASY (like Yellow Page).
Developed systems to support advertisement analysis and management for internal use.
Provided technical consultations for customers and resellers.

Built the website of USC Club of Private Equity and Venture Capital.

Project Experience

Curated website that geo-searches content introducing restaurants/food/etc.
Collected over 100,000 geocoded data from pixnet.net​ using Python, Scrapy and Google geocode API.
Worked with Node, ExpressJs, Gulp, MongoDB, Docker on the backend, and worked with React, Semantic-UI on the frontend.

Github

Developed a two-player fighting game with Swift, SpriteKit and Bluetooth technology, which was invited to the GamePipe Showcase 2015.
Combined the photo taking feature into the game as characters of gamers.

Github

Crawled websites to collect over 1M weapon data with Tika and Nutch, indexed and ranked weapon data with Solr, and analysed and visualised weapon data with Banana and D3.

1-setup-NUTCH 2-setup-SOLR 3-visualizedata-D3

Github

Built a multimedia search engine with Java and JavaFx.
Searched matched videos in accordance to the similarity in color, motion and sound.

Github

Developed a prototype mobile app-like website with jQuery-Mobile.
Designed a mobile application collecting events around USC to promote USC Students involvement.

Details Github

Implement an Houses Search App with Java, AWS, php, and Zillow api, which users can search houses by area, address, prices, years and etc.

Built 3D Game Tetris with C++ and Orge 3D Framework, supporting multiplayer mode.
Constructed a Demo version with Flash (Actionscript).

Github

Call

(213)-425-6651

Email Address

huayingt@usc.edu

Location

Bay Area